How EMD Funding Works in Bakersfield, CA
EMD funding covers the earnest money deposit on your Bakersfield contract — typically $5,000 to $25,000 — wired directly to your California escrow company, usually within 24 hours of a complete file. The deposit must be refundable under the contingency or due-diligence terms of the contract. You lock up the property without committing your own cash before you’ve found an end buyer or finished your numbers.

How it closes in Bakersfield (escrow state)
California is an escrow state, so the earnest money is held by a Bakersfield escrow company, not an attorney. We wire the deposit straight to your escrow officer once we have written confirmation it’s refundable per the contract’s contingency period. Cancel within that window and the deposit returns to escrow and back to us — documented and clean, with none of your own capital exposed. California is also a dry-funding state, so any closing disbursement waits on Kern County recording — but that affects the close, not your protected deposit.

Does dry-funding affect my earnest money in Bakersfield? +
Not for the deposit itself. California's dry-funding rule governs disbursement at closing — escrow releases only after the deed records with Kern County — but earnest money is simply held by the escrow company during your contingency period. As long as your contract keeps the EMD refundable through inspection or due diligence, your deposit is protected. If the deal dies in that window, the funds return to escrow and back to us, fully documented.
